原文:Linux下clock计时函数学习

平时在Linux和Winows下都有编码的时候,移植代码的时候免不了发现一些问题。 . 你到底准不准 关于clock 计时函数首先是一段简单的测试代码,功能为测试从文本文件读取数据并赋值给向量最后打印输出的运行时间。int main int argc, char argv clock t t clock ifstream in data.txt vector lt int gt v for int ...

2016-02-17 13:14 1 12990 推荐指数:

查看详情

clock()函数计时的坑

程序中经常用time()函数来返回当前系统时间的秒数,来计时或计算时间差。如果需要用到更高精度的时间,就会自然想到用clock()函数。想当然的认为它返回从程序开始tick数,用clock()/CLOCKS_PER_SEC就能得到以秒计数的时间了。然而结果不是这样,看下面的程序log。一行开头 ...

Thu Mar 07 19:26:00 CST 2019 0 2870
linux clock_gettime() 获取时间函数

#include <time.h> int clock_gettime(clockid_t clk_id, struct timespec* tp); 可以根据需要,获取不同要求的精确时间 参数 clk_id : 检索和设置的clk_id指定的时钟时间 ...

Thu Jul 19 23:53:00 CST 2018 0 15562
linux clock_gettime() 获取精确时间函数

#include <time.h> int clock_gettime(clockid_t clk_id, struct timespec* tp); clock_gettime() 函数是基于linux 操作系统的。 可以根据需要,获取不同要求的精确时间,通过第一个参数 ...

Thu Oct 29 19:47:00 CST 2015 0 7916
【C++clock()函数学习(计算自己代码运行时间)】

  相信很多小伙伴在做题的时候都担心自己的程序会不会超时,就会不断优化自己的程序,但是在数据比较小的情况我们人类根本察觉不到微小的变化,就很难发现自己的代码是否被优化。所以今天,我将教大家一个clock()函数,可以计算自己代码需要运行消耗的时间。 很明显 ...

Wed Jul 10 16:28:00 CST 2019 0 628
C语言两个计时函数clock()和gettimeofday()

刚刚做了项测试,要用某程序在Linux平台的运行时间(需精确到ms级)上报。 一开始用的是clock()函数: 头文件:time.h 函数原型:clock_t clock(void); 功能:该函数返回值是硬件滴答数,要换算成秒,需要除以CLK_TCK或者 CLOCKS_PER_SEC ...

Sun May 28 00:49:00 CST 2017 0 3936
Linux内核的ioctl函数学习

Linux内核的ioctl函数学习 来源:Linux公社 作者:Linux   我这里说的ioctl函数是在驱动程序里的,因为我不知道还有没有别的场合用到了ioctl, 所以就规定了我们讨论的范围。为什么要写篇文章呢,是因为我前一阵子被ioctl给搞混了,这几天才弄明白 ...

Thu Apr 20 20:18:00 CST 2017 0 2382
(二)linux计时函数

linux计时函数,用于获取当前时间。 1. gettimeofday() 函数 结构体 精度 time() time_t s gettimeofday ...

Mon Jun 04 09:05:00 CST 2018 0 1146
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M